"A 10% additional tariff will be imposed on countries that support BRICS" - Trump
![]() 1604 Monday, 07 July, 2025, 11:10 Washington will impose a 10% tariff on countries that support the "anti-American" policy of the BRICS, US President Donald Trump announced on the Truth Social social network. "Any country that supports the anti-American policy of the BRICS will be subject to an additional 10% tariff. There will be no exceptions to this policy," the politician wrote. BRICS is an intergovernmental association created in 2006 by Russia, China, India and Brazil, in 2011 it was joined by South Africa, then Egypt, the UAE, Ethiopia, Iran, and from January 2025 - Indonesia. |
